Tammy says the quotient of 793 ÷ 6 is 132 r1. Use multiplication to check Tammy's answer. × 6 + 1 = Tammy's answer is .

To find the answer, we should multiply 132 by 6.

132*6=792

792+1=793

Tammy’s answer is correct.
